You really want a list? I can tell you I'm not going to tell you everything, but the general stuff I will. Evo 8 tranny, tcase, diff, front knuckles and hubs, front axles, rear gsx knuckles, rear evo hubs, 2g awd rear subframe. And a ton more of odds and ends

You need parts from a 2nd GEN GSX
V6 you need a custom bell housing made to adapt the Evo T-Case, custom piece...highly expensive unless you cut a corner and have the bell housing welded to make a "conversion" item.
Sub frame needs to be modified or a custom tubular one made to clear T-Case and driveshaft. More money
Rear subframe, gas tank...list goes on and the V6 is by far going to be the most expensive platform to make AWD compared to the 4cyl.
